Recent Development

  • Global factoring volumes remained resilient in 2024–2025; FCI reports world factoring volume ≈ €3.66T in 2024, +2.7% YoY, outpacing global product sales growth. 

  • Regional Europe: EUF reports €2.048T factoring & commercial finance turnover in Europe (2024), ≈ 11.2% of EU GDP

  • Providers continue to roll out ESG-linked and digitally-automated offerings (e.g., an ESG-linked factoring solution announced by HSBC in 2024).


Drivers

  • SME working-capital needs and tight bank lending standards make receivables finance attractive. 

  • E-invoicing/ERP integration & digitization lower onboarding and risk-assessment costs, widening eligibility.

  • Growth in cross-border/open-account trade that benefits export/import factoring.


Restraints

  • Macroeconomic/credit-cycle risk (buyer defaults) can tighten limits and raise fees. 

  • Regulatory fragmentation (assignment of receivables, data/privacy) across jurisdictions complicates scaling.

  • Perception of cost vs. loans—price sensitivity among SMEs where education is low. 


Regional segmentation analysis (high level)

  • Europe: largest organized region; €2.05T turnover (2024), concentrated in top five markets.

  • Asia–Pacific: strong growth with major bank-affiliated factors (e.g., ICBC, Mizuho); digital adoption rising.

  • North America: diversified mix of bank factors and independents; active in trucking, staffing, healthcare and B2B services.

  • LATAM / MENA / Africa: smaller share but expanding via bank programs and fintech portals.


Emerging Trends

  • Platformization & AI-assisted underwriting (automated fraud checks, dynamic limits).

  • ESG-linked pricing and sustainable supply-chain programs by global banks. 

  • Blended receivables programs (combining factoring with supply-chain finance / dynamic discounting).


Top Use Cases

  • Domestic & international factoring for manufacturing, wholesale, logistics/trucking, staffing, and healthcare receivables.

  • Export factoring for SMEs shipping on open-account terms (risk protection + collections).


Major Challenges

  • Fraud / duplicate financing risks; need for registries and data-sharing to prevent double assignment. 

  • Margin compression in competitive tenders and during low-risk periods.

  • Cross-border legal enforceability and documentary compliance.


Attractive Opportunities

  • SME digitization waves (e-invoicing mandates) create low-cost acquisition channels. 

  • Sector verticals (trucking, staffing, healthcare) where speed and collections expertise command premium spreads. 

  • Emerging markets with growing open-account trade and bank-led programs.

Market size / values (compare scopes — “factoring” vs “invoice factoring”)

Definitions vary (some reports model total factoring services; others isolate “invoice factoring”). Use the scope that matches your slides.

  • Global factoring services (broad):
    — Grand View Research: USD ~4.19T (2023) → USD ~8.19T (2030)CAGR ~10.5% (2024–2030)
    — Mordor Intelligence: USD ~4.41T (2025) → USD ~5.92T (2030)CAGR ~6.05%.
    — ResearchAndMarkets (example): USD ~5.73T (2025) → USD ~7.93T (2029)CAGR ~8.5%.

  • Invoice factoring (narrower scope):
    — The Business Research Company: USD ~3.09T (2024) → USD ~3.46T (2025)CAGR ~11.9% (’24→’25) (longer-term growth expected). 
    — Valuates/Allied (PRNewswire summary): USD ~1.95T (2021) → USD ~4.62T (2031)CAGR ~9.4%

  • Regional datapoints:
    — Europe total turnover (EUF): €2.048T (2024).
    — Global industry body (FCI) volume: €3.66T (2024), +2.7% YoY.

Why numbers differ: publisher scope (domestic+international factoring vs invoice-only; inclusion of reverse/confirming; revenue vs turnover) and base years/methodology.
